The Cyrillic Capital Letter Shha With Descender (Ԧ) is a specialized character used in the Tati and Juhuri languages. It represents a voiceless pharyngeal fricative /ħ/ or a similar sound. Architecturally, it combines the ‘Shha’ (Һ) form with a descender hook on the right stem.

⚠️ Note: Do not confuse with ԧ (Lowercase U+0527) or the standard Latin h.
